Toyota has launched the new model RAV4 plug-in hybrid electric vehicle (PHEV) ( earlier post ) through dealerships in Japan. The new RAV4 PHEV aims to boost the fun-to-drive appeal of RAV4, adopting the newly developed Toyota Hybrid System (THS II). The fifth generation RAV4 was released in April 2019.

At the same time, battery costs, which are the single largest driver of TCO for BEVs and PHEVs, are declining further and faster than projected just a few years ago. BCG estimates, confirmed by several sources, have batteries’ per-kilowatt-hour cost falling to between $80 and $105 by 2025 and to between $70 and $90 by 2030.

They have an engine and, typically, a much larger battery than hybrids, good for covering the commute without using gasoline but affording the long driving range of a fuel tank. If you don’t charge a plug-in hybrid, it will typically use a small portion of the battery with the engine and together function as a hybrid.
